Punch The Clock
Elvis Costello & The Attractions
Fred Freeman
Costello returns with a set of mostly upbeat, easily accessible pop-rock songs that could finally bring him a measure of pop singles success.
This is some of Costello's most commercial mainstream music, especially on the up-tempo tracks like "Let Them All Talk." After forays into country and other projects with more limited appeal, Costello is aiming for a broader public with this new release.
